public class Dstu2BundleFactory implements IVersionSpecificBundleFactory {
private Bundle myBundle;
private FhirContext myContext;
private String myBase;
public Dstu2BundleFactory(FhirContext theContext) {
myContext = theContext;
}
private void addResourcesForSearch(List extends IBaseResource> theResult) {
List includedResources = new ArrayList();
Set addedResourceIds = new HashSet();
for (IBaseResource next : theResult) {
if (next.getIdElement().isEmpty() == false) {
addedResourceIds.add(next.getIdElement());
}
}
for (IBaseResource nextBaseRes : theResult) {
IResource next = (IResource) nextBaseRes;
Set containedIds = new HashSet();
for (IResource nextContained : next.getContained().getContainedResources()) {
if (nextContained.getId().isEmpty() == false) {
containedIds.add(nextContained.getId().getValue());
}
}
List references = myContext.newTerser().getAllPopulatedChildElementsOfType(next, BaseResourceReferenceDt.class);
do {
List addedResourcesThisPass = new ArrayList();
for (BaseResourceReferenceDt nextRef : references) {
IResource nextRes = (IResource) nextRef.getResource();
if (nextRes != null) {
if (nextRes.getId().hasIdPart()) {
if (containedIds.contains(nextRes.getId().getValue())) {
// Don't add contained IDs as top level resources
continue;
}
IdDt id = nextRes.getId();
if (id.hasResourceType() == false) {
String resName = myContext.getResourceDefinition(nextRes).getName();
id = id.withResourceType(resName);
}
if (!addedResourceIds.contains(id)) {
addedResourceIds.add(id);
addedResourcesThisPass.add(nextRes);
}
}
}
}
// Linked resources may themselves have linked resources
references = new ArrayList();
for (IResource iResource : addedResourcesThisPass) {
List newReferences = myContext.newTerser().getAllPopulatedChildElementsOfType(iResource, BaseResourceReferenceDt.class);
references.addAll(newReferences);
}
includedResources.addAll(addedResourcesThisPass);
} while (references.isEmpty() == false);
Entry entry = myBundle.addEntry().setResource(next);
if (next.getId().hasBaseUrl()) {
entry.setFullUrl(next.getId().getValue());
}
BundleEntryTransactionMethodEnum httpVerb = ResourceMetadataKeyEnum.ENTRY_TRANSACTION_METHOD.get(next);
if (httpVerb != null) {
entry.getRequest().getMethodElement().setValueAsString(httpVerb.getCode());
}
}
/*
* Actually add the resources to the bundle
*/
for (IBaseResource next : includedResources) {
Entry entry = myBundle.addEntry();
entry.setResource((IResource) next).getSearch().setMode(SearchEntryModeEnum.INCLUDE);
if (next.getIdElement().hasBaseUrl()) {
entry.setFullUrl(next.getIdElement().getValue());
}
}
}
@Override
public void addResourcesToBundle(List theResult, BundleTypeEnum theBundleType, String theServerBase, BundleInclusionRule theBundleInclusionRule, Set theIncludes) {
if (myBundle == null) {
myBundle = new Bundle();
}
List includedResources = new ArrayList();
Set addedResourceIds = new HashSet();
for (IBaseResource next : theResult) {
if (next.getIdElement().isEmpty() == false) {
addedResourceIds.add((IdDt) next.getIdElement());
}
}
for (IBaseResource nextBaseRes : theResult) {
IResource next = (IResource) nextBaseRes;
Set containedIds = new HashSet();
for (IResource nextContained : next.getContained().getContainedResources()) {
if (nextContained.getId().isEmpty() == false) {
containedIds.add(nextContained.getId().getValue());
}
}
List references = myContext.newTerser().getAllResourceReferences(next);
do {
List addedResourcesThisPass = new ArrayList();
for (ResourceReferenceInfo nextRefInfo : references) {
if (!theBundleInclusionRule.shouldIncludeReferencedResource(nextRefInfo, theIncludes))
continue;
IResource nextRes = (IResource) nextRefInfo.getResourceReference().getResource();
if (nextRes != null) {
if (nextRes.getId().hasIdPart()) {
if (containedIds.contains(nextRes.getId().getValue())) {
// Don't add contained IDs as top level resources
continue;
}
IdDt id = nextRes.getId();
if (id.hasResourceType() == false) {
String resName = myContext.getResourceDefinition(nextRes).getName();
id = id.withResourceType(resName);
}
if (!addedResourceIds.contains(id)) {
addedResourceIds.add(id);
addedResourcesThisPass.add(nextRes);
}
}
}
}
includedResources.addAll(addedResourcesThisPass);
// Linked resources may themselves have linked resources
references = new ArrayList();
for (IResource iResource : addedResourcesThisPass) {
List newReferences = myContext.newTerser().getAllResourceReferences(iResource);
references.addAll(newReferences);
}
} while (references.isEmpty() == false);
Entry entry = myBundle.addEntry().setResource(next);
BundleEntryTransactionMethodEnum httpVerb = ResourceMetadataKeyEnum.ENTRY_TRANSACTION_METHOD.get(next);
if (httpVerb != null) {
entry.getRequest().getMethodElement().setValueAsString(httpVerb.getCode());
}
populateBundleEntryFullUrl(next, entry);
BundleEntrySearchModeEnum searchMode = ResourceMetadataKeyEnum.ENTRY_SEARCH_MODE.get(next);
if (searchMode != null) {
entry.getSearch().getModeElement().setValue(searchMode.getCode());
}
}
/*
* Actually add the resources to the bundle
*/
for (IResource next : includedResources) {
Entry entry = myBundle.addEntry();
entry.setResource(next).getSearch().setMode(SearchEntryModeEnum.INCLUDE);
populateBundleEntryFullUrl(next, entry);
}
}
private void populateBundleEntryFullUrl(IResource next, Entry entry) {
if (next.getId().hasBaseUrl()) {
entry.setFullUrl(next.getId().toVersionless().getValue());
} else {
if (isNotBlank(myBase) && next.getId().hasIdPart()) {
IdDt id = next.getId().toVersionless();
id = id.withServerBase(myBase, myContext.getResourceDefinition(next).getName());
entry.setFullUrl(id.getValue());
}
}
}

@Override
public void initializeBundleFromBundleProvider(IRestfulServer> theServer, IBundleProvider theResult, EncodingEnum theResponseEncoding, String theServerBase, String theCompleteUrl,
boolean thePrettyPrint, int theOffset, Integer theLimit, String theSearchId, BundleTypeEnum theBundleType, Set theIncludes) {
myBase = theServerBase;
int numToReturn;
String searchId = null;
List resourceList;
if (theServer.getPagingProvider() == null) {
numToReturn = theResult.size();
if (numToReturn > 0) {
resourceList = theResult.getResources(0, numToReturn);
} else {
resourceList = Collections.emptyList();
}
RestfulServerUtils.validateResourceListNotNull(resourceList);
} else {
IPagingProvider pagingProvider = theServer.getPagingProvider();
if (theLimit == null) {
numToReturn = pagingProvider.getDefaultPageSize();
} else {
numToReturn = Math.min(pagingProvider.getMaximumPageSize(), theLimit);
}
numToReturn = Math.min(numToReturn, theResult.size() - theOffset);
if (numToReturn > 0) {
resourceList = theResult.getResources(theOffset, numToReturn + theOffset);
} else {
resourceList = Collections.emptyList();
}
RestfulServerUtils.validateResourceListNotNull(resourceList);
if (theSearchId != null) {
searchId = theSearchId;
} else {
if (theResult.size() > numToReturn) {
searchId = pagingProvider.storeResultList(theResult);
Validate.notNull(searchId, "Paging provider returned null searchId");
}
}
}
for (IBaseResource next : resourceList) {
if (next.getIdElement() == null || next.getIdElement().isEmpty()) {
if (!(next instanceof BaseOperationOutcome)) {
throw new InternalErrorException("Server method returned resource of type[" + next.getClass().getSimpleName() + "] with no ID specified (IResource#setId(IdDt) must be called)");
}
}
}
addResourcesToBundle(new ArrayList(resourceList), theBundleType, theServerBase, theServer.getBundleInclusionRule(), theIncludes);
addRootPropertiesToBundle(null, theServerBase, theCompleteUrl, theResult.size(), theBundleType, theResult.getPublished());
if (theServer.getPagingProvider() != null) {
int limit;
limit = theLimit != null ? theLimit : theServer.getPagingProvider().getDefaultPageSize();
limit = Math.min(limit, theServer.getPagingProvider().getMaximumPageSize());
if (searchId != null) {
if (theOffset + numToReturn < theResult.size()) {
myBundle.addLink().setRelation(Constants.LINK_NEXT)
.setUrl(RestfulServerUtils.createPagingLink(theIncludes, theServerBase, searchId, theOffset + numToReturn, numToReturn, theResponseEncoding, thePrettyPrint, theBundleType));
}
if (theOffset > 0) {
int start = Math.max(0, theOffset - limit);
myBundle.addLink().setRelation(Constants.LINK_PREVIOUS)
.setUrl(RestfulServerUtils.createPagingLink(theIncludes, theServerBase, searchId, start, limit, theResponseEncoding, thePrettyPrint, theBundleType));
}
}
}
}
@Override
public void initializeBundleFromResourceList(String theAuthor, List extends IBaseResource> theResources, String theServerBase, String theCompleteUrl, int theTotalResults,
BundleTypeEnum theBundleType) {
myBundle = new Bundle();
myBundle.setId(UUID.randomUUID().toString());
ResourceMetadataKeyEnum.PUBLISHED.put(myBundle, InstantDt.withCurrentTime());
myBundle.addLink().setRelation(Constants.LINK_FHIR_BASE).setUrl(theServerBase);
myBundle.addLink().setRelation(Constants.LINK_SELF).setUrl(theCompleteUrl);
myBundle.getTypeElement().setValueAsString(theBundleType.getCode());
if (theBundleType.equals(BundleTypeEnum.TRANSACTION)) {
for (IBaseResource nextBaseRes : theResources) {
IResource next = (IResource) nextBaseRes;
Entry nextEntry = myBundle.addEntry();
nextEntry.setResource(next);
if (next.getId().isEmpty()) {
nextEntry.getRequest().setMethod(HTTPVerbEnum.POST);
} else {
nextEntry.getRequest().setMethod(HTTPVerbEnum.PUT);
if (next.getId().isAbsolute()) {
nextEntry.getRequest().setUrl(next.getId());
} else {
String resourceType = myContext.getResourceDefinition(next).getName();
nextEntry.getRequest().setUrl(new IdDt(theServerBase, resourceType, next.getId().getIdPart(), next.getId().getVersionIdPart()).getValue());
}
}
}
} else {
addResourcesForSearch(theResources);
}
myBundle.getTotalElement().setValue(theTotalResults);
}
